Former Kuswag learner to graduate

Monya Bester's mother is very pleased with her achievement.

FORMER Kuswag Skool learner, Monya Bester, achieved 17 distinctions in her fourth and final year studying Bachelor of Health Sciences in Sport Coaching and Human Movement Sciences at North-West University.

She finished in the top five every year and achieved a total of 32 distinctions in four years. Her mother, Magda, was very happy with her outstanding dedication to her studies.

“She has always been a very dedicated person who always put her studies first above all else,” said Magda.
